Output 32f66889d5716044d027c1ab1815c3d5f6f7e7ec6d9f9ce7e409146a54969773:1

value
40000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72cccfc1979618678c739e2b6833320e3de86064 OP_EQUAL
address
3CA2Jy7QCroGjZSu1awwZ2KnLQRTsH6UEP
transaction
32f66889d5716044d027c1ab1815c3d5f6f7e7ec6d9f9ce7e409146a54969773
spent
true